Elsewhere in Stroud

St Laurence Christmas Tree Festival: 26th November-3rd December Now in its 13th year, this celebrated Christmas Tree Festival brings together members of the Stroud community under one roof. In the church of St Laurence, you will find over 135 Christmas trees, each decorated by different community groups, individuals and businesses.
